How many batteries can a 100 watt solar panel use?
With a 100 watt solar panel, you could use one 85Ah 12V battery. But your best option would be to use one 100Ah 12V battery. If you want to make your battery last long you should avoid letting the battery reach 50% discharge.
What is a 100 watt solar panel?
A 100-watt solar panel is a solar PV module that comes with a power rating of 100W. As you’d anticipate, this means that the panel has a power output of up to a hundred watts of DC power in an hour when it’s running under excellent conditions. Fundamentally, the power ratings of solar panels are evaluated under ideal conditions.
Can a 100 watt solar panel charge a 12V battery?
Yes, a 100 watt solar panel can charge a 12V battery. In fact, one 100Ah 12V battery can be fully charged by a 100 watt 12V solar panel. However, charging larger batteries or multiple batteries may take a longer time.

How much power does a 100 watt solar panel produce?
A 100-watt solar panel produces around 5 to 6 amps of power per peak sun hour. In direct sunlight, this would amount to around 30 amp-hours per day.
